Zack Kozlak

Managing Director at TrailRunner International

Zack Kozlak is a Managing Director based in New York. He advises global companies on financial communications, corporate reputation, crisis and issues management, executive thought leadership, and landmark events like complex M&A transactions. He has supported clients with multiple public offerings, including a direct listing. Zack has also advised management and boards in activist shareholder engagements.

Prior to joining TrailRunner, Zack worked in the New York office of Burson-Marsteller, serving a broad set of Fortune 50 clients on corporate and financial communications, crisis and issues management, public affairs, and brand protection. While at Burson his teams won several industry awards for their work in crisis response and issues management.

Prior to joining Burson, Zack worked for the Boston Red Sox on several key initiatives, and he earned special recognition by the Red Sox front office for his exceptional service. Before that, Zack worked in Washington, D.C. for U.S. Senator Amy Klobuchar (D-MN), and interned in Washington for the Retail Industry Leaders Association (RILA).

Zack graduated magna cum laude from the Boston College School of Arts & Sciences Honors Program (BA, International Studies). Zack is an outdoor sports enthusiast and an Accredited Interscholastic Coach. He enjoys cheering for his Minnesota teams, and he has a passion for volunteerism and serving others.
